It is perhaps the most romantic place in Aveyron, in any case a pearl placed on the lake of Sarrans which surprises visitors at the bend of the bend.

 An island of greenery which protects a superb chapel (an XNUMXth century listed monument) which itself houses the relics of Saint Gausbert. On the banks of the Lac de Sarrans. Makes it a magical place. At the prairie, on the tip of the peninsula, swimming is supervised (days and times contact us - thank you)

Free tour.

Nature and sports activities, a popular fishing spot.

At the Laussac peninsula on the Lac de Sarrans


– Swimming is supervised (from 2/07 until 27/08 from 14:30 p.m. to 18 p.m.)


– Hiking:


PR The Laussac peninsula: 14,5 km / 4 h 45 / difficult level


PR the Jou trail: 4,5km / 1h30 / average level


– The peninsula is also a friendly place where there are two summer restaurants.


Picnic areas.
